Ken Aho is a Professor in the Department of Biological Sciences at Idaho State University, specializing in Community Ecology and Biostatistics. He has held this position since 2011 and leads the Aho Lab, focusing on foundational and applied statistical methods for biologists using R. His research integrates ecological theory with statistical rigor, addressing topics like alpine vegetation dynamics, microbial communities, and non-perennial stream networks. He developed the asbio R package and authored the textbook Foundational and Applied Statistics for Biologists Using R, emphasizing pedagogical tools for statistical education.
- Education:
- B.S. Biology (1995), Idaho State University
- M.S. Environmental and Ecological Statistics (2007), Montana State University
- Ph.D. Biology (2006), Montana State University
- Postdoctoral Fellow (2007–2011), Idaho State University (Alpine plant ecology)
Research interests span alpine ecology, biostatistical methodologies, and ecological modeling. Notable projects include studying invasive species impacts, reclamation of post-mining landscapes, and the development of the streamDAG R package for analyzing non-perennial stream networks. His work also explores microbial interactions in alpine soils and atmospheric microbial communities.
Publications emphasize statistical applications in ecology, stream ecology, and biodiversity. Current trends in his articles address stream intermittency, carbon budgets, and microbiome connectivity. He advises graduate students, including S. Warix, C. Wheeler, and C. T. Bond, and teaches courses like Advanced Data Analysis and R Programming.
No scientific awards are explicitly listed, though his contributions to statistical pedagogy and ecological research are widely recognized. His lab integrates fieldwork, computational modeling, and interdisciplinary collaborations.
